Tips and Tricks for the Multiplication Table of 862

Understanding the multiplication table of 862 can be challenging because of the larger number involved. But with tips and tricks, it becomes easier. Let’s look into some:  

Break the numbers into smaller parts:

Breaking the numbers into smaller parts will make it easy to learn multiplication.  
For example, 862 × 4  
Here, 862 can be broken into 800 + 62  
(800 × 4) + (62 × 4) = 3,200 + 248  
= 3,448.

Use of flashcards:

On one side of the flashcard, write the multiplication problems.  
For example:  
Front: 862 × 3  
Back: 2,586.

Repeated patterns:

The unit digits in the 862 times table repeat every 5 multiples.  
For example: The unit digits repeat in the cycle: 2, 4, 6, 8, 0. After every 5 multiples, the cycle restarts.

FAQs on Table of 862

1.What are the factors of 862?

1, 2, 431, and 862 are the factors of 862.

2.What are the multiples of 862?

862, 1,724, 2,586, 3,448, 4,310, 5,172, 6,034, 6,896, 7,758, 8,620, and so on. These are the multiples of 862.

3.How can kids practice the table of 862?

To practice the table of 862, kids can use flashcards, puzzles, games, and practice. 

4.What is the pattern of the table of 862?

The table of 862 follows the pattern of 2, 4, 6, 8, and 0.

5.Is 862 a prime number?

No, 862 is not a prime number because it can be divided by 2 and 431.
